FilterAutomatingOptions

자동 필터링에 관한 설정 정보

상세 설명

그리드 에서 옵션으로 설정할 때는 필요한 정보만 넣으면 된다.

예제 코드

grid.setFilteringOptions({
     automating: {
         dateCategorize: false
     }
});

프로퍼티 정보

dateCategorize


dateCategorize: boolean

날짜를 분류할 것인지의 여부

상세 설명

true 시 설정한 foramt 들을 기준으로한 텍스트로 연도, 분기, 또는 월 단위로 분류된다.

년도 수가 2 이상, 월 수가 7 이상이어야 연도별로 분류된다.

년도 당 월 수가 7 이상이어야 분기별로 분류된다.

총 일 수가 10 이상이고 월 수가 4 이상이어야 월별로 분류된다.

false 시 트리 형태가 아닌 리스트 형태로 항목마다 필터 탭이 만들어진다.

FilterAutomatingOptions.dateCategoryCallback 을 지정하여 사용자 지정의 분류를 할 수 있다.

기본값

true

dateDayFormat


dateDayFormat: string

항목에 표시되는 일 형식

기본값

'YYYY-MM-DD'

dateMonthFormat


dateMonthFormat: string

항목에 표시되는 월 형식

기본값

'M월'

dateQuarterFormat


dateQuarterFormat: string

항목에 표시되는 분기 형식

기본값

'Q분기'

dateYearFormat


dateYearFormat: string

항목에 표시되는 연도 형식

기본값

'YYYY년도'

filteredDataOnly


filteredDataOnly: boolean

FilterSelector에 표시되는 데이터

상세 설명

true이면 전체 데이터가 아닌 filtering되어서 보여지고 있는 데이터만 filterSelector에 표시된다.

DataColumn.autoFiltertrue인 column에만 적용된다.

기본값

false

lookupDisplay


lookupDisplay: boolean

Column의 lookupDisplay가 true이면 value 대신 label을 표시한다.

기본값

false

numberCategorize


numberCategorize: boolean

수를 분류할 것인지의 여부

상세 설명

true 시 중복제거된 아이템이 16개 이상인 경우, 최대값과 최소값의 차를 기준으로 4개에서 8개 사이의 구간으로 분류 되어진다. 아이템이 15개 이하거나 false 시 트리 형태가 아닌 리스트 형태로 항목마다 필터 탭이 만들어진다. FilterAutomatingOptions.numberCategoryCallback 을 지정하여 사용자 지정의 분류를 할 수 있다.

기본값

true

textCategorize


textCategorize: boolean

텍스트를 분류할 것인지의 여부

상세 설명

true 시 아이템이 16개 이상인 경우에 문자열의 첫 문자를 기준으로 숫자, 알파벳 대문자, 알파벳 소문자, 유니코드, 그 외로 분류 되어진다. 아이템이 15개 이하거나 false 시 트리 형태가 아닌 리스트 형태로 항목마다 필터 탭이 만들어진다. FilterAutomatingOptions.textCategoryCallback 을 지정하여 사용자 지정의 분류를 할 수 있다.

기본값

false

콜백 정보

dateCategoryCallback


dateCategoryCallback: CategoryCallback

날짜를 분류하기 위한 콜백

상세 설명

반환 값 및 설명은 FilterCategory 참조

numberCategoryCallback


numberCategoryCallback: CategoryCallback

수를 분류하기 위한 콜백

상세 설명

반환 값 및 설명은 FilterCategory 참조

textCategoryCallback


textCategoryCallback: CategoryCallback

문자열을 분류하기 위한 콜백

상세 설명

반환 값 및 설명은 FilterCategory 참조